Estonia - Import of Goods Vehicles, with Spark-Ignition Internal Combustion Piston Engine
Since 2014, Estonia Import of Goods Vehicles, with Spark-Ignition Internal Combustion Piston Engine was down by 4.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 23 among other countries in Import of Goods Vehicles, with Spark-Ignition Internal Combustion Piston Engine at €1,850,094.6. Estonia is overtaken by Greece, which was ranked number 22 at €6,229,010 and is followed by Croatia at €1,408,549. France lead the ranking with €190,439,220.83 in 2019, that is a fall of 4.3% versus 2018. United Kingdom, Italy and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Portugal witnessed the best average annual growth at +76% per year, while Malta witnessed the worst performance at -24.6% per year.
